While hair loss directly due to a deficiency in a nutrient is believed to be rare, a large industry has developed in recent years based on nutrient "hair analysis". Several clinics and laboratories claim to be able to define a deficiency of a nutrient or vitamin through analyzing a sample of your hair. The Internet enables these clinics and laboratories to advertise worldwide and a quick search should provide you with numerous web sites offering hair analysis.

These investigations have a simple yes - no question, is the drug, toxin, or heavy metal there or not? There is also the advantage that most of the metals and toxins looked for have a fairly stable chemical nature. They are un-reactive compared to nutrients so they are less likely to change with exposure to the environment. With nutrient analysis the laboratory is attempting to define shades of gray - exactly how much of the nutrient is there? This has been shown to be virtually impossible to do. Even sending hair samples from the same donor to different analysis labs yields contrasting results.

This is not to say all hair analysis is invalid. Analysis of hair is a very useful method of defining exposure to heavy metals. A hair analysis can reveal whether a person has had a chronic exposure to chemical toxins in the environment. And of course hair analysis can be used to show that an individual has been using illegal drugs. The test is known as Hair Follicle Drug Testing. These forms of hair analysis are looking for the presence of a particular chemical that is not normally found in hair, or looking for expression over and above that which is known to be safe.

Are You Nutritionally Fit?

A recent survey of nearly 700 Americans showed that 72 percent believe they are healthy eaters, yet government data proves otherwise.

The USDA recently revealed that Americans get plenty of protein and carbohydrates, but often fall short on key nutrients such as magnesium, potassium and vitamins C and E.

"Fifty years ago, we only recognized extreme cases of vitamin deficiencies, like scurvy, which is caused by a lack of vitamin C," said Carroll Reider, MS, RD, Nature Made vitamins director of scientific affairs and education. "Science has advanced. We now know that even small amounts of vitamin deficiencies hurt us much more than people realize."

While most Americans appear well fed, a key question is: Are you nutritionally fit? To assess your nutritional condition, Reider posed the following questions:

Do you shun the sun? People who wear sunscreen, live in northern climates or have darker skin may not receive optimal levels of vitamin D, which is made following exposure to sunlight. Vitamin D helps the body absorb calcium and may also promote ovarian, breast, prostate, heart and colon health. Reider suggests 1,000 IU of vitamin D daily for people who spend most of their time indoors and those who don't synthesize vitamin D easily, such as darker- skinned individuals and the elderly. Vitamin D food sources include milk and fatty types of fish; however, it is hard to achieve optimal intake through food alone. It is also available in supplement form.

Do your meals lack color? Does dinner typically consist of meat, starch and the same green vegetable? For optimal health, add more colors to your diet. Vegetables such as steamed carrots, peppers and red cabbage add vibrant hues to the dinner plate while citrus wedges brighten the standard bed of greens. Eating a variety of fruits and vegetables maximizes nutrient intake and provides antioxidants, which help fight free radicals that may cause premature aging. "A multivitamin formulated for your age and gender is also a good way to compensate for dietary imbalances," Reider said.

Is fish a regular dish? The American Heart Association recommends two servings of fish per week. Reider suggests salmon and tuna, which are rich in omega-3 fatty acids. Some studies suggest omega-3 fatty acids may promote heart health. Other sources include walnuts, flaxseed or vitamins.

Pleural Mesothelioma

What is Pleural Mesothelioma?

Pleural Mesothelioma or malignant pleural mesothelioma is cancer in the layer of the lungs that can spread to the lungs. The spread of the tumor over the pleura results in pleural thickening. This hinders the reflexivity of the pleura and encases the lungs in an increasing restrictive belt. With the lungs thus restricted, they get constricted in no time and a person is always out of breath.

Pleural mesothelioma can be:
- Diffuse and malignant (carcinogenic)
- Localized and benign (non-cancerous)                                  

Benign pleural mesothelioma can be removed surgically, but the malignant tumors are the real terror heads.

Most common among other mesothelioma cases, Pleural Mesothelioma is caused due to exposure to blue asbestos for a longer period of time, say 20 years, in which time the disease incubates only to show its fearful countenance via certain symptoms.

The symptoms of Pleural Mesothelioma

The symptoms of Pleural Mesothelioma include difficulty in breathing, difficulty in sleeping, pain in the chest and abdominal regions, blood vomits, weakness, weight loss, loss of appetite, lower back pains, persistent coughing, hoarseness of voice, sensory loss and difficulty in swallowing.

Diagnosis of Pleural Mesothelioma

The first step is to go through a chest X-ray or a CT scan (computed chest tomograph), which will reveal a pleural thickening and an effusion. This is followed by a bronchoscopy. Another method is a biopsy, which can be a needle biopsy, an open biopsy, or a thoracoscopy, where a mini camera is inserted inside the body and with that a tissue sample is attained for further diagnosis.

Treatment of Pleural Mesothelioma

Treatment is directly proportional to the time of the revelation of the disease, i.e., at an early stage the tumor can be removed through surgery.

A pioneering mesothelioma treatment option is immunotherapy, e.g., intrapleural inoculation of Bacillus Calmette-Guerin (BCG) is a useful mesothelioma treatment in which an effort is made to intensify the immune response.

Radiation treatment and chemotherapy is probably then the answer to the malignant pleural mesothelioma, but this can aid the pain management only; there's no escaping death with Pleural Mesothelioma.

Side effects of Treatment

The side effects and penalty of mesothelioma lung cancer treatment are more than its treatment, which is damaged healthy tissues, a state of absolute fatigue ness; excessive radiation causes the skin to become red, dry and itchy.

Other side effects of radiotherapy are nausea and vomiting, diarrhea, urinary discomfort and a sudden reduction in the number of white blood corpuscles.

The average life span of a person with Pleural Mesothelioma is up to 6 months to a year and the maximum can reach up to 5 years - the magnesium-silicate mineral fibers take its toll that's more than painful.

Other factors that may accelerate the possibility of pleural mesothelioma are chronic lung infections, tuberculous pleuritis, radiation (Thorotrast), exposure to the simian virus 40 (SV40) or mineral fibers (Zeolite) and tobacco smoking to a certain extent.

Though learning how to choose good tie material is important, learning which tie style looks best with a certain shirt or proper occasion is key.

Nowadays, there are four tie styles commonly in use. There is the four-in-hand, half-Windsor, Windsor and Pratt knot. The three mentioned first are the classic knots. They have been choking, I mean adorning men's necks years and decades before.

Pratt knot is a recent tie style having been around only since 1989. Of course, talking about tie styles are not complete unless we talk about the disadvantages and advantages of these styles of neckties and bows. The four-in-hand style is the best style for those only starting to wear ties. For one, they are easily mastered and suit almost all occasion. However, they are suited best for shirts with narrow collars since they are asymetric and would look sloppy with wide collars.

Half windsor style knot is more difficult to tie. They do suit most occasions and shirt styles because of their symmetry and formal look. Windsor knots are best for formal occasions. This is a wide tie style and is best for shirts with white collars. Conversely, they would look over the top and improper with narrow collars. The more modern Pratt knott is the most versatile tie style. This is not too wide nor narrow and suits every shirt style. It can also be used for occasions. Plus, it also gives you a neat and polished look without sacrificing a relaxed vibe. However, for more formal occasions (weddings, high society affairs) a bow tie is preferred.
